Installing wainscoting is a straightforward and attractive way to decorate empty walls and create a traditional ambiance in a sitting room or home office. Wainscoting can transform your living space, add extra insulation and even cover up unsightly wall damage. Wainscoting installation costs depend on the size of your room and the going rate for contractors in your area. The cost of having wainscoting professionally installed varies widely and is dependent on the prices charged by local contractors.

Contractors typically charge higher rates in areas with steeper costs of living. Meanwhile, opting for wood veneer or plastic panels is a good way to save money and get the look of wainscoting on a budget.

You'll also need some basic equipment to install wainscoting, which should cost around $120 (CAD 160) to purchase from a hardware store. If you already have some of the equipment from previous projects, or if you can borrow it from friends or family, this will shave a little off the overall installation cost.
